10,000 lb Rotary SPO10 Symmetric Low-Profile Two-Post Lift with 2 Ft. Column Extension

A two-post lift takes a beating every day. Trucks, vans, low sports cars, all on the same two arms. If the arms won't reach the lift points, or the columns eat your door clearance, every job gets harder than it should be.

The Rotary SPO10 is a symmetric two-post lift rated for 10,000 lbs, built on Rotary's original Double-S columns. Standard 2-stage arms swing under low cars and reach the lift points with three-position flip-up FA adapters. This is Rotary's extended-height build, with a 2 ft. column extension for bays that need more room above the vehicle.

Features

  • 10,000 lb capacity β€” cars, light trucks, vans and SUVs on the same set of arms
  • 2 ft. column extension β€” Rotary's extended-height configuration, factory built rather than bolted on
  • 75 5/8" rise β€” measured from the lowest position of the supplied adapters to full cylinder stroke
  • 2 HP, 208-230V single-phase motor β€” full rise in 45 seconds, back down in 40
  • Original Double-S columns β€” the single-piece multi-bend profile gives the carriage a secure channel for smooth travel up and down
  • 102 1/2" drive-thru clearance β€” 114 1/2" between the columns, in an 11' 5 5/8" overall footprint
  • 31" to 54" arm reach β€” three-position flip-up FA adapters match the vehicle's lift points
  • ALI Gold Certified β€” independently certified and performance tested to 20,000 cycles

Symmetric Lifting Built for Trucks and Vans

Rotary's SPO series uses true-symmetric lifting designed for trucks and vans. The vehicle's center of gravity sits directly between the columns for a smooth, balanced lift, and the door line clears the columns so techs get in and out without dings.

The standard 2-stage arms swing under low vehicles and reach the lift points with three-position flip-up FA adapters. The whole assembly is joined with a single pin, so it holds position under load and one arm set covers a low sedan and a work truck.

Sized to Your Bay

This is the extended-height build. A standard SPO10 stands 11' 8 1/2" and clears a 12' ceiling. With the 2 ft. column extension this lift stands 13' 8 1/2" and needs a 13' 10" ceiling.

The footprint does not change. Overall width is 11' 5 5/8", drive-thru clearance is 102 1/2" and the columns sit 114 1/2" apart, so the lift still fits a standard 12' x 24' bay. The extension buys you height, not floor space.

Measure your ceiling against the 13' 10" minimum before you commit. If you don't need the extra room overhead, Rotary builds the same lift in its standard configuration.

Specs

Technical Specifications

Lifting Capacity 10,000 lbs
Configuration Symmetric
Rise 75 5/8"
Lift Design 2-stage low-profile two-post
Arms Standard 2-stage with three-position flip-up FA adapters
Arm Reach (Front & Rear), Min/Max 31" / 54"
Min. Adapter Height 4 3/4"
Column Extension 2 ft. (included)
Overall Height (with 2 ft. extension) 13' 8 1/2"
Min. Ceiling Height (with 2 ft. extension) 13' 10"
Overall Width 11' 5 5/8"
Drive-Thru Width 8' 6 1/2" (102 1/2")
Inside Columns 114 1/2"
Min. Bay Size 12' x 24'
Motor / Voltage 2 HP β€” 208-230V, 1Ø
Time of Full Rise / Descent 45 seconds / 40 seconds
Performance Testing 20,000 cycles
Certification ALI Gold Certified
Weight 1,605 lbs
